I like TRP Spyre, especially for such an easy adjustment. I have QR axles, so after mounting wheel there is quite often need to adjust caliper a little. With TRP I do not have to move whole caliper, because it is possible to adjust both pads separately. Very easy, quick and precise work.

My advice is to use compresionless housings. Lever feels much better than on standard. Brake pads are very average, but because it is standard Shimano shape from lower level brakes, good aftermarket spares are quite cheap.
